使用多个字段列表作为查询条件查询数据库
在数据库操作中,经常会遇到需要根据多个字段列表来查询数据的情况。在MySQL中,我们可以使用多个字段列表作为查询条件来实现这一目的。本文将介绍如何使用多个字段列表作为查询条件来查询数据库中的数据,并提供相应的代码示例。
准备工作
在开始之前,确保已经安装了MySQL数据库,并且已经创建了相应的数据库和表。在本文示例中,我们将使用一个名为users
的表来演示如何使用多个字段列表作为查询条件。
CREATE TABLE users (
id INT PRIMARY KEY,
name VARCHAR(50),
age INT,
gender VARCHAR(10)
);
INSERT INTO users (id, name, age, gender) VALUES
(1, 'Alice', 25, 'Female'),
(2, 'Bob', 30, 'Male'),
(3, 'Charlie', 22, 'Male'),
(4, 'David', 28, 'Male'),
(5, 'Eve', 35, 'Female');
使用多个字段列表作为查询条件
在MySQL中,我们可以使用AND
和OR
操作符将多个字段列表组合在一起作为查询条件。下面是一个使用多个字段列表作为查询条件的示例:
SELECT * FROM users
WHERE age > 25 AND gender = 'Female';
上面的查询语句将会查询users
表中年龄大于25岁并且性别为女性的用户数据。我们可以根据实际需求来动态修改查询条件,以获取符合条件的数据。
代码示例
下面是一个完整的代码示例,演示了如何使用多个字段列表作为查询条件来查询数据库中的数据:
SELECT * FROM users
WHERE age > 25 AND gender = 'Female';
查询结果
根据上面的代码示例,我们可以得到符合条件的数据如下:
pie
title 数据查询结果分布
"Female Age > 25" : 20
"Male Age > 25" : 10
通过以上代码示例,我们成功使用多个字段列表作为查询条件查询了数据库中的数据。在实际应用中,我们可以根据具体需求来灵活运用多个字段列表的查询条件,以便获取所需的数据。
结语
本文介绍了如何在MySQL中使用多个字段列表作为查询条件来查询数据库中的数据,并提供了相应的代码示例。希望本文对您有所帮助,如有疑问或建议欢迎留言交流。感谢阅读!